
Fleming’s Prime Steakhouse & Wine Bar: Prime steaks, fine wines, exceptional service
Fleming’s Prime Steakhouse & Wine Bar in Greensboro offers fine dining with prime steaks, seafood, and a curated wine list. Guests consistently praise attentive, professional service and knowledgeable recommendations. Celebrations are welcomed with personal touches, like birthday cards and dessert treats. Highlights include A5 wagyu, shellfish tower for two, and a refined, welcoming atmosphere.

Hand-cut, USDA Prime steaks cooked to perfection, including filet mignon and ribeye.
Extensive wine list with over 100 options by the glass, curated for pairing with meals.
Fresh shellfish platter for two, featuring oysters, shrimp, and lobster.
Elegant spaces for special events, birthdays, and corporate gatherings.
Indulgent desserts like New York cheesecake and truffles to complete your meal.
Craft cocktails and premium spirits served in a sophisticated bar setting.
